Обзоры [78] |
Компьютеры [46] |
Видеокарты [10] |
Материнские платы [17] |
Кулеры [9] |
Сети, WI-FI, VoIP [10] |
Мультимедия [15] |
ТВ-тюнеры [8] |
GPS-навигация [5] |
Носители информации [3] |
Софт, игры, Windows [31] |
Системы безопасности [14] |
Своими руками [1] |
Это интересно [51] |
Надо знать [52] |
Помощь [75] |
Все популярные гипервизоры для Windows — Hyper-V, VirtualBox, VMware – предусматривают запуск виртуальных машин (ВМ) с загрузочных ISO-образов и флешек. Запуск ВМ с последних не в каждом случае будет процессом без заморочек: без танцев с бубном с флешек UEFI запускаются только ВМ на базе ПО EFI в программах VirtualBox и VMware. Как упростить запуск ВМ с флешек в остальных случаях?
Для этого можно создать так называемую виртуальную флешку – всё содержимое реального USB-носителя перенести на виртуальный жёсткий диск и, соответственно, запускать ВМ с него. Но содержимое необходимо переносить вместе со структурой физической флешки — чтобы виртуальный диск унаследовал все разделы, если их несколько (например, в случае с Mac OS или Chrome OS), а также атрибуты загрузочного устройства (если это не носитель UEFI). Сделать это можно как минимум двумя способами, описанными ниже. Все действия в нашем случае будут проводиться с VMware Workstation. В других программах для виртуализации необходимо действовать по аналогии. 1. Программа R-Drive Imagehttps://www.drive-image.com/ru/ Первый способ создания виртуальной флешки – это перенос структуры и содержимого реального USB-носителя на виртуальный диск с помощью программы-бэкапера R-Drive Image. Открываем параметры существующей ВМ и кликаем «Жёсткий диск». Добавляем ещё один диск. Тип контроллера оставляем по умолчанию. Создаём новый диск. Указываем его размер: пусть он будет примерно таким, как размер флешки, но немногим всё же пусть отличается. Это нужно чтобы не спутать устройства при клонировании. Сохраняем в виде одного файла. Указываем путь размещения. Жмём «Готово». Запускаем ВМ, подключаем к ней реальную флешку. В гостевой ОС устанавливаем триал-версию программы R-Drive Image. В её окне выбираем «Копировать Диск на Диск». В графе «Источник» выбираем реальную флешку. В графе «Приемник» — только что созданный виртуальный диск. Жмём «Далее». И – «Начать». По завершении клонирования выходим из программы. Теперь в проводнике гостевой ОС у нас появилось два идентичных устройства. Можем отключить реальную флешку от ВМ. Равно как и можем отключить виртуальный диск от текущей ВМ и использовать его для запуска других ВМ. 2. Программа RufusВторой способ создания виртуальной флешки – это использование возможностей программы Rufus 3.1. В обновлённой версии 3.х эта программа, в довесок к существующим функциям создания загрузочных USB-устройств, научилась клонировать реальные флешки в файлы VHD. А VHD совместим и с Hyper-V, и с VirtualBox, и VMware. Запускаем Rufus 3.1 в хост-системе. Выбираем нужный USB-носитель, если их несколько подключено, в графе «Устройство». Далее жмём кнопку в виде дискетки. Указываем путь хранения файла VHD. Ждём завершения операции и закрываем Rufus. 3. Подключение виртуальной флешки и запуск с неёИтак, виртуальная флешка создана, как её подключить к ВМ и, соответственно, запустить? В параметрах ВМ кликаем жёсткий диск. Добавляем новый диск. Выбираем существующий. В окне проводника указываем путь к папке хранения файла VHD. В графе отображения файлов ставим «Все файлы». И кликаем нашу виртуальную VHD-флешку. Готово. На EFI-машинах входим в BIOS – либо используем кнопку на панели инструментов гипервизора, либо при запуске ВМ жмём F2. В окне загрузчика выбираем Hard Drive с тем номером, под которым он числится в общем перечне подключённых виртуальных дисков, но в исчислении с нуля. В нашем случае виртуальная флешка является вторым диском ВМ, потому в EFI-прошивке она значится как Hard Drive 1.0. На обычных ВМ, созданных на базе эмуляции BIOS Legacy, чтобы загрузиться с виртуальной флешки, необходимо в параметрах ВМ указать её первым жёстким диском. Нужно удалить все имеющиеся диски машины и добавить их заново, указав виртуальную флешку первой. | |
Просмотров: 365 | |
Всего комментариев: 0 | |